Robert Half Accounting Manager/Supervisor in Las Vegas, Nevada

Description

We are seeking an experienced Senior Cost Accountant/ Analyst to join our team in Las Vegas, Nevada. This role is in the construction materials industry and involves providing financial support and analysis, collaborating with different functions to ensure the accuracy of financial data, and working on cross-functional/regional projects.

ABOUT THE ROLE

To provide financial support and analysis on regional results, forecasts and plans. Timely compilation of reporting and analysis to assist business leaders in making informed decisions. Collaborate with other functions to ensure completeness and accuracy of financial data. Work with Corporate group to ensure reported results, forecasts and plans are accurate and variance communicated and understood. Cost accounting.

WHAT YOU'LL BE DOING

  • Demonstrates a commitment to communicating, improving and adhering to safety policies in all work environments and areas.

  • Review and analyze regional financial results and identify areas for improvement.

  • Assist in all Financial Planning activities with respect to monthly forecast and Mid-Term plan. Costing and cost accounting.

  • Analyze financial plan data to identify potential risks/opportunities and present findings along with proposed actions to senior management for review and decision making.

  • Provides accurate and timely reporting of actual performance versus forecast and budget to the management team. Provides information to management by assembling and summarizing data; preparing reports, presenting findings, analyses and recommendations.

  • Performs special projects and analysis as directed. Reconciles transactions by comparing and correcting data.

  • Maintain work in process (WIP) schedules and managing accuracy of the sub-ledgers.

  • Analyze complex financial scenarios to provide detailed insight into business drivers and potential value creation opportunities; this may require gathering and interpreting of marketing, logistics, manufacturing, and system (SAP) data.

  • Perform financial modeling and quantitative analysis of information.

  • Represent finance on cross functional/regional projects and initiatives. Support monthly, quarterly and annual reporting requirements.

    Requirements

WHAT WE ARE LOOKING FOR

*Bachelor degree (Accounting or Finance) required; Master's degree preferred.

*3-5+ years of experience working in accounting and/ or finance

*CPA/ CMA/ CFA/ MBA considered favorably

*SAP erp system experience preferred

*Analysis experience in a manufacturing environment preferred. Previous experience in Aggregates & Construction materials environment.
